What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that websites place on your device (computer, smartphone, tablet) when you visit them. They’re widely used to make websites work efficiently, remember your preferences, and provide information to the website owners. Cookies may be “first-party” (set by our Site) or “third-party” (set by services we use, like analytics providers).

In addition to cookies, we may use similar technologies such as:

  • Web beacons/pixel tags: Small transparent images embedded in pages or emails that tell us whether content was viewed
  • Local storage: Browser storage that holds data similar to cookies but with larger capacity
  • Scripts: Small programs that run in your browser to support Site functionality

Browser Settings

Most web browsers allow you to control cookies through their settings. You can set your browser to block cookies, delete existing cookies, or notify you when cookies are placed. Here’s how to manage cookies in major browsers:

Google Chrome: Settings → Privacy and security → Cookies and other site data

Mozilla Firefox: Options → Privacy & Security → Cookies and Site Data

Safari: Preferences → Privacy → Cookies and website data

Microsoft Edge: Settings → Cookies and site permissions → Manage and delete cookies
